What Are Mobile Stair Devices?

Mobile stair devices are portable equipment designed to help individuals ascend or descend stairs safely. Unlike stair lifts or elevators that require fixed installations, these devices are compact and can be easily moved or stored when not in use. They typically come in two forms:

  • Motorized Stair Climbing Devices: These feature powered mechanisms that assist users in climbing stairs with minimal effort.
  • Manual Stair Assist Devices: Operated manually, these are lightweight and often require assistance from a caregiver for usage.

The choice between these types depends on the user's needs, budget, and physical capabilities. Both options aim to reduce physical strain while improving accessibility.

Key Features of Mobile Stair Devices

The effectiveness of mobile stair devices lies in their thoughtful design and user-centric features. Common attributes include:

  • Portability: Most devices are lightweight and foldable, making them easy to transport or store.
  • Safety Mechanisms: Features such as anti-slip treads, seatbelts, and sturdy handrails enhance user safety.
  • Adjustable Settings: Adjustable speed controls and customizable seating arrangements cater to different user preferences.
  • Battery Efficiency: Motorized versions often come with long-lasting batteries for uninterrupted use.

These features make mobile stair devices versatile tools for improving mobility without requiring significant changes to the home environment.

The Benefits for Seniors

For seniors facing mobility challenges, mobile stair devices offer numerous advantages:

  1. Enhanced Independence: Users can navigate their homes without constant assistance from caregivers or family members.
  2. Cost-Effectiveness: Compared to installing an elevator or a permanent stairlift, these devices provide a budget-friendly solution.
  3. Improved Safety: With built-in safety measures, they minimize the risk of falls or injuries on stairs.
  4. Flexibility: Their portable nature allows users to take them along when traveling or relocating.

Seniors can regain confidence in managing daily activities while maintaining their dignity and autonomy.

Factors to Consider When Choosing a Mobile Stair Device

Selecting the right device requires careful evaluation of various factors. Some considerations include:

  • User Needs: Assess the user’s mobility level and whether they prefer motorized or manual assistance.
  • Staircase Design: Ensure compatibility with the type and structure of stairs in the home.
  • Weight Capacity: Verify that the device can safely accommodate the user’s weight.
  • Budget: Compare prices across models while factoring in long-term costs like maintenance or battery replacements.

A consultation with healthcare professionals or mobility experts may also be beneficial when making a decision.

The Role of Technology in Modern Designs

The integration of technology has revolutionized mobile stair devices, making them more efficient and user-friendly. Innovations include touch-screen controls, smart sensors that detect obstructions on stairs, and remote operation capabilities. Some advanced models even offer connectivity features that allow monitoring through smartphone apps. These technological enhancements not only improve functionality but also add an extra layer of convenience for both users and caregivers.
